E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ases an exquisite oil on canvas painting titled "Highland Cattle" by the English School. The artwork, measuring 76.4x46.0 cm, can be found at the Laing Art Gallery in Newcastle-upon-Tyne, UK. With its misty and rural landscape, this piece transports viewers to the picturesque highlands of Britain. The focal point of the painting is a herd of majestic Highland cattle peacefully grazing along a scenic road in the Scottish countryside. These iconic farm animals are beautifully depicted with their long horns and shaggy coats blending harmoniously into the mist-filled valley behind them. The artist's skillful brushstrokes capture both the serene atmosphere and rugged beauty of Scotland's highlands. The rolling hills and distant mountains add depth to this enchanting scene, evoking a sense of tranquility that resonates with nature lovers. This remarkable artwork from eTyne & Wear Archives & Museums is not only visually stunning but also serves as a testament to British artistry. It celebrates Scotland's rich agricultural heritage while showcasing the timeless charm of its landscapes.
